The Basics of Laser Cutting Machines

Laser cutting machines utilize a high-powered laser beam to cut materials with exceptional precision. The process involves directing the output of a high-power laser through optics, which is then focused on the material to be cut. The laser melts, burns, vaporizes, or is blown away by a jet of gas, leaving an edge with a high-quality surface finish. These machines are renowned for their accuracy, speed, and ability to cut intricate designs, making them a favorite in various industries, from automotive to fashion.

Fiber Laser Cutting Machines: Efficiency and Precision

Among the various types of laser cutting machines, fiber laser cutting machines stand out due to their efficiency and precision. Unlike CO2 lasers, which use gas as a medium, fiber lasers utilize a solid-state setup where the laser light is generated by banks of diodes and then channeled through fiber optic cables. This configuration offers several benefits:

Higher Efficiency: Fiber lasers convert electrical power into laser light more efficiently, reducing operational costs.

Enhanced Precision: The focused beam of a fiber laser is smaller, allowing for finer cuts and more detailed designs.

Maintenance-Free Operation: With fewer moving parts and no need for gas, fiber lasers are often more reliable and require less maintenance.

These attributes make fiber laser cutting machines ideal for applications that demand high precision, such as aerospace, electronics, and medical device manufacturing.

Laser Engraving Cutting Machines: Versatility in Design

Laser engraving cutting machines combine the capabilities of both cutting and engraving, making them incredibly versatile. These machines can cut through various materials like wood, acrylic, plastic, and metals, while also offering the ability to engrave intricate patterns and designs on the surface of the material. The dual functionality of these machines is particularly beneficial for industries like signage, custom gifts, and awards.

Key features of laser engraving cutting machines include:

Dual Functionality: The ability to switch between cutting and engraving modes allows for greater creative flexibility.

Precision and Detail: These machines can produce highly detailed engravings, making them suitable for personalized items and intricate artwork.

Material Versatility: Capable of working with a wide range of materials, these machines open up numerous possibilities for customization and design.
